CancellationTokenSource CancellationTokenSource CancellationTokenSource CancellationTokenSource Constructors

Definition

Überlädt

CancellationTokenSource() CancellationTokenSource() CancellationTokenSource()

Initialisiert eine neue Instanz der CancellationTokenSource-Klasse.Initializes a new instance of the CancellationTokenSource class.

CancellationTokenSource(Int32) CancellationTokenSource(Int32) CancellationTokenSource(Int32) CancellationTokenSource(Int32)

Initialisiert eine neue Instanz der CancellationTokenSource-Klasse, die nach der angegebene Verzögerung in Millisekunden abgebrochen wird.Initializes a new instance of the CancellationTokenSource class that will be canceled after the specified delay in milliseconds.

CancellationTokenSource(TimeSpan) CancellationTokenSource(TimeSpan) CancellationTokenSource(TimeSpan) CancellationTokenSource(TimeSpan)

Initialisiert eine neue Instanz der CancellationTokenSource-Klasse, die nach der angegebenen Zeitspanne abgebrochen wird.Initializes a new instance of the CancellationTokenSource class that will be canceled after the specified time span.

CancellationTokenSource() CancellationTokenSource() CancellationTokenSource()

Initialisiert eine neue Instanz der CancellationTokenSource-Klasse.Initializes a new instance of the CancellationTokenSource class.

public:
 CancellationTokenSource();
public CancellationTokenSource ();
Public Sub New ()
Siehe auch

CancellationTokenSource(Int32) CancellationTokenSource(Int32) CancellationTokenSource(Int32) CancellationTokenSource(Int32)

Initialisiert eine neue Instanz der CancellationTokenSource-Klasse, die nach der angegebene Verzögerung in Millisekunden abgebrochen wird.Initializes a new instance of the CancellationTokenSource class that will be canceled after the specified delay in milliseconds.

public:
 CancellationTokenSource(int millisecondsDelay);
public CancellationTokenSource (int millisecondsDelay);
new System.Threading.CancellationTokenSource : int -> System.Threading.CancellationTokenSource
Public Sub New (millisecondsDelay As Integer)

Parameter

millisecondsDelay
Int32 Int32 Int32 Int32

Das Zeitintervall in Millisekunden, das vor dem Abbrechen dieser CancellationTokenSource-Klasse gewartet wird.The time interval in milliseconds to wait before canceling this CancellationTokenSource.

Ausnahmen

millisecondsDelay ist kleiner als -1.millisecondsDelay is less than -1.

Hinweise

Der Countdown für das millisecondsDelay beginnt während des Aufrufes des Konstruktors.The countdown for the millisecondsDelay starts during the call to the constructor. Wenn abgelaufen ist, wird die CancellationTokenSource erstellte abgebrochen (wenn Sie nicht bereits abgebrochen wurde). millisecondsDelayWhen the millisecondsDelay expires, the constructed CancellationTokenSource is canceled (if it has not been canceled already).

Bei nachfolgenden CancelAfter Aufrufen von wird millisecondsDelay die für das CancellationTokenSourceerstellte zurückgesetzt, wenn Sie nicht bereits abgebrochen wurde.Subsequent calls to CancelAfter will reset the millisecondsDelay for the constructed CancellationTokenSource, if it has not been canceled already.

CancellationTokenSource(TimeSpan) CancellationTokenSource(TimeSpan) CancellationTokenSource(TimeSpan) CancellationTokenSource(TimeSpan)

Initialisiert eine neue Instanz der CancellationTokenSource-Klasse, die nach der angegebenen Zeitspanne abgebrochen wird.Initializes a new instance of the CancellationTokenSource class that will be canceled after the specified time span.

public:
 CancellationTokenSource(TimeSpan delay);
public CancellationTokenSource (TimeSpan delay);
new System.Threading.CancellationTokenSource : TimeSpan -> System.Threading.CancellationTokenSource
Public Sub New (delay As TimeSpan)

Parameter

delay
TimeSpan TimeSpan TimeSpan TimeSpan

Das Zeitintervall, das vor dem Abbrechen dieser CancellationTokenSource-Klasse abgewartet wird.The time interval to wait before canceling this CancellationTokenSource.

Ausnahmen

Hinweise

Der Countdown für die Verzögerung beginnt während des Aufrufes des Konstruktors.The countdown for the delay starts during the call to the constructor. Wenn die Verzögerung abläuft, wird die CancellationTokenSource erstellte abgebrochen, wenn Sie nicht bereits abgebrochen wurde.When the delay expires, the constructed CancellationTokenSource is canceled, if it has not been canceled already.

Bei nachfolgenden CancelAfter Aufrufen von wird die Verzögerung für die CancellationTokenSourceerstellte zurückgesetzt, wenn Sie nicht bereits abgebrochen wurde.Subsequent calls to CancelAfter will reset the delay for the constructed CancellationTokenSource, if it has not been canceled already.

Gilt für: